概述
在当今互联网环境中,V2Ray作为一种强大的网络代理工具,越来越受到重视。对于希望在路由器上安装OpenWrt系统的用户,运行V2Ray可以提供更稳定、更安全的网络连接。
什么是OpenWrt?
OpenWrt是一款基于Linux的路由器操作系统,它允许用户更为自由地控制自己的网络设备。由于其高度可定制性,OpenWrt非常受到技术爱好者的欢迎。
什么是V2Ray?
V2Ray是一款开源代理工具,旨在帮助用户更好地实现网络加速和隐私保护。V2Ray理想用于翻越墙(翻墙),确保用户的网络连接安全且不被监控。
安装V2Ray在OpenWrt中的步骤
1. 准备工作
- 确保路由器已安装OpenWrt。
- 确保路由器具有足够的存储空间来安装V2Ray。
2. 更新软件包列表
在SSH终端中输入以下命令更新软件包列表: bash opkg update
3. 安装V2Ray
使用以下命令进行安装: bash opkg install luci-app-v2ray
4. 下载V2Ray核心
可以通过以下命令下载安装V2Ray核心: bash git clone https://github.com/v2ray/v2ray-core.git cd v2ray-core
5. 配置V2Ray
在安装完成后,需要配置V2Ray。
-
打开配置文件: bash nano /etc/v2ray/config.json
-
根据自己的需求编辑配置,如传输方式、服务器地址等。
配置V2Ray的详细步骤
1. 选择传输协议
V2Ray支持多种传输协议,如 TCP、WebSocket、KCP 等。
- 根据需求选择合适的协议。
2. 填写服务器信息
在配置文件中填写你的V2Ray服务器的地址、端口、ID等信息。
3. 设置监听地址
确保监听地址设置正确。通常情况下,0.0.0.0表示监听所有地址。
4. 配置路由
可以根据需要配置V2Ray的路由规则,以便实现代理。
测试V2Ray是否运行成功
使用以下命令检查V2Ray是否正常运行: bash /etc/init.d/v2ray start
然后查看运行状态: bash /opt/v2ray/v2ray -test -config=/etc/v2ray/config.json
常见问题解答(FAQ)
Q1:如何查看V2Ray的日志?
A1:可以通过以下命令查看V2Ray的运行日志: bash cat /var/log/v2ray.log
Q2:V2Ray无法连接怎么办?
A2:检查以下几点:
- 服务器地址是否正确。
- 本地防火墙是否阻止了连接。
- 网络是否稳定。
Q3:如何在OpenWrt上自动启动V2Ray?
A3:在安装后,使用以下命令使V2Ray开机启动: bash /etc/init.d/v2ray enable
Q4:V2Ray支持哪些平台?
A4:V2Ray可以运行在多种操作系统上,包括 Windows、macOS、Linux 以及移动端的 Android 和 iOS。
Q5:如何升级V2Ray?
A5:可以通过以下命令进行升级: bash opkg upgrade v2ray
总结
在OpenWrt环境中运行V2Ray的过程涉及安装、配置等多个步骤。通过上述的指导,希望能够帮助你成功实现这一目标,以便获得更快、更安全的网络体验。熟悉每个步骤,并根据实际需求调整配置,才能充分发挥V2Ray的强大功能。